    I suspect that there might be a better technique.
    Attach the assignment here.

     

    You have not indicated what environment you are in or any screen shots or other information.

    Assuming 2D sketch environment - edit the sketch (or start a new sketch as appropriate).

    Start one of the sketch commands (like line).
    Click on the down arrow next to Draw (wait a minute - you did say you are using 2010 or later with Ribbon Interface?).

    You should see command for Precise Input (this can be promoted to main tab if desired).
